Step 4: Verify SDK parity. The Korvane JS and Swift SDKs reached feature parity in release 3.2, so plugin authors can target either client with identical hook signatures. Before publishing, run the parity checker against both bundles and confirm no deprecated calls remain. The checker requires an authenticated session against the Korvane registry, so add the signing secret to your .env file on the next line.

vault entry, yajop-bafop: ARCHIVE_KEY3=8d4

## Queue log compaction — Brindlemq

Compaction runs nightly on the Brindlemq broker. If disk alerts fire, check whether the compactor is stalled: a stuck segment blocks the whole cycle. Restarting the compactor is safe; it resumes from the last checkpoint. Do not delete segments manually. Escalate if two consecutive runs fail. The compactor reads these settings at startup:

settings of tagef-bawif:
DRUIX_HOST=druix.zemvarlabs.internal
DRUIX_PORT=8000

Welcome to the Faretide pricing team. Our current experiment, Lanternfare, tests dynamic ticket tiers for the Orvala venue network. Please read the experiment charter carefully before touching any allocation weights, since misconfigured buckets skew revenue reports for weeks. Access to the experiment config store is gated; unlock it at first login with the passphrase provided below.

recovery phrase for fajep-yaweg: gilath-sorox-wenius-rusdor-keliel-zorius

**INC-2290: Flaky DNS resolution — resolver credentials expired**

For new folks: our Quillport staging resolver intermittently fails lookups for internal hosts. Root cause is the sidecar's credentials expired, so it silently falls back to a public resolver that can't see our zones. Restart alone won't fix it. Re-register the sidecar with the internal registry service using the key provided below.

app token of bahaf-tajeg = zpat23_SjjsllwiLmXbtS65veZaV47

Subject: N+1 fix shipped — what you need to know

Hi — quick heads-up before your first shift. We patched the Lattica GraphQL resolver that fired one query per order line; it now batches through the Corral loader. Latency on order pages dropped hard. If p95 spikes again, suspect a new unbatched resolver. Triage steps and dashboards are on the internal page below.

runbook for tafof-yawif: https://confluence.tolvaqsys.internal/display/display/browse/pages/7be3